// Copyright (c) 2015 The Chromium Authors. All rights reserved.
// Use of this source code is governed by a BSD-style license that can be
// found in the LICENSE file.
#include "chrome/browser/ui/android/autofill/autofill_keyboard_accessory_view.h"
#include "base/android/jni_android.h"
#include "base/android/jni_string.h"
#include "chrome/browser/android/resource_mapper.h"
#include "chrome/browser/ui/android/view_android_helper.h"
#include "chrome/browser/ui/autofill/autofill_popup_controller.h"
#include "chrome/browser/ui/autofill/autofill_popup_layout_model.h"
#include "components/autofill/core/browser/popup_item_ids.h"
#include "components/autofill/core/browser/suggestion.h"
#include "jni/AutofillKeyboardAccessoryBridge_jni.h"
#include "ui/android/view_android.h"
#include "ui/android/window_android.h"
#include "ui/base/resource/resource_bundle.h"
#include "ui/gfx/geometry/rect.h"
using base::android::JavaParamRef;
using base::android::ScopedJavaLocalRef;
namespace autofill {
namespace {
void AddToJavaArray(const Suggestion& suggestion,
int icon_id,
JNIEnv* env,
jobjectArray data_array,
size_t position,
bool deletable) {
int android_icon_id = 0;
if (!suggestion.icon.empty())
android_icon_id = ResourceMapper::MapFromChromiumId(icon_id);
Java_AutofillKeyboardAccessoryBridge_addToAutofillSuggestionArray(
env, data_array, position,
base::android::ConvertUTF16ToJavaString(env, suggestion.value),
base::android::ConvertUTF16ToJavaString(env, suggestion.label),
android_icon_id, suggestion.frontend_id, deletable);
}
} // namespace
AutofillKeyboardAccessoryView::AutofillKeyboardAccessoryView(
AutofillPopupController* controller)
: controller_(controller), deleting_index_(-1) {
JNIEnv* env = base::android::AttachCurrentThread();
java_object_.Reset(Java_AutofillKeyboardAccessoryBridge_create(env));
}
AutofillKeyboardAccessoryView::~AutofillKeyboardAccessoryView() {
JNIEnv* env = base::android::AttachCurrentThread();
Java_AutofillKeyboardAccessoryBridge_resetNativeViewPointer(env,
java_object_);
}
void AutofillKeyboardAccessoryView::Show() {
JNIEnv* env = base::android::AttachCurrentThread();
ui::ViewAndroid* view_android = controller_->container_view();
DCHECK(view_android);
Java_AutofillKeyboardAccessoryBridge_init(
env, java_object_, reinterpret_cast<intptr_t>(this),
view_android->GetWindowAndroid()->GetJavaObject());
UpdateBoundsAndRedrawPopup();
}
void AutofillKeyboardAccessoryView::Hide() {
controller_ = nullptr;
JNIEnv* env = base::android::AttachCurrentThread();
Java_AutofillKeyboardAccessoryBridge_dismiss(env, java_object_);
}
void AutofillKeyboardAccessoryView::UpdateBoundsAndRedrawPopup() {
JNIEnv* env = base::android::AttachCurrentThread();
size_t count = controller_->GetLineCount();
ScopedJavaLocalRef<jobjectArray> data_array =
Java_AutofillKeyboardAccessoryBridge_createAutofillSuggestionArray(env,
count);
positions_.resize(count);
size_t position = 0;
// Place "CLEAR FORM" item first in the list.
for (size_t i = 0; i < count; ++i) {
const Suggestion& suggestion = controller_->GetSuggestionAt(i);
if (suggestion.frontend_id == POPUP_ITEM_ID_CLEAR_FORM) {
AddToJavaArray(suggestion, controller_->layout_model().GetIconResourceID(
suggestion.icon),
env, data_array.obj(), position, false);
positions_[position++] = i;
}
}
for (size_t i = 0; i < count; ++i) {
const Suggestion& suggestion = controller_->GetSuggestionAt(i);
if (suggestion.frontend_id != POPUP_ITEM_ID_CLEAR_FORM) {
bool deletable =
controller_->GetRemovalConfirmationText(i, nullptr, nullptr);
AddToJavaArray(suggestion, controller_->layout_model().GetIconResourceID(
suggestion.icon),
env, data_array.obj(), position, deletable);
positions_[position++] = i;
}
}
Java_AutofillKeyboardAccessoryBridge_show(env, java_object_, data_array,
controller_->IsRTL());
}
void AutofillKeyboardAccessoryView::SuggestionSelected(
JNIEnv* env,
const JavaParamRef<jobject>& obj,
jint list_index) {
// Race: Hide() may have already run.
if (controller_)
controller_->AcceptSuggestion(positions_[list_index]);
}
void AutofillKeyboardAccessoryView::DeletionRequested(
JNIEnv* env,
const JavaParamRef<jobject>& obj,
jint list_index) {
if (!controller_)
return;
base::string16 confirmation_title, confirmation_body;
if (!controller_->GetRemovalConfirmationText(
positions_[list_index], &confirmation_title, &confirmation_body)) {
return;
}
deleting_index_ = positions_[list_index];
Java_AutofillKeyboardAccessoryBridge_confirmDeletion(
env, java_object_,
base::android::ConvertUTF16ToJavaString(env, confirmation_title),
base::android::ConvertUTF16ToJavaString(env, confirmation_body));
}
void AutofillKeyboardAccessoryView::DeletionConfirmed(
JNIEnv* env,
const JavaParamRef<jobject>& obj) {
if (!controller_)
return;
CHECK_GE(deleting_index_, 0);
controller_->RemoveSuggestion(deleting_index_);
}
void AutofillKeyboardAccessoryView::ViewDismissed(
JNIEnv* env,
const JavaParamRef<jobject>& obj) {
if (controller_)
controller_->ViewDestroyed();
delete this;
}
void AutofillKeyboardAccessoryView::InvalidateRow(size_t) {
}
// static
bool AutofillKeyboardAccessoryView::RegisterAutofillKeyboardAccessoryView(
JNIEnv* env) {
return RegisterNativesImpl(env);
}
} // namespace autofill
